Output 03be77a576ffd3771331b2429dd55287b0f879b3328653ec2cbfc4e84c55b666:1

value
66043701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7575506c1f2299254e67c4087485576249de611c OP_EQUAL
address
MJcDq1CyAnJGS7K188ykDCZX64KPCePWp2
transaction
03be77a576ffd3771331b2429dd55287b0f879b3328653ec2cbfc4e84c55b666
spent
true